The 2SC4411 is a high-performance NPN silicon transistor designed and manufactured by ON Semiconductor, a leader in the semiconductor industry. This transistor is specifically engineered to provide excellent switching speeds and high current capabilities, making it an ideal choice for a wide range of electronic applications.
Key Features
- Voltage Rating: The 2SC4411 has a collector-base voltage (VCBO) of 60V, which ensures stable operation in circuits with medium voltage requirements.
- Current Handling: With a collector current (IC) rating of up to 5A, this transistor can handle significant power for its size, suitable for amplification and switching applications.
- High-Speed Switching: It offers fast switching speeds, which is critical for applications that require rapid state changes, such as digital logic circuits.
- Power Dissipation: The device is capable of dissipating up to 1W of power, allowing it to manage moderate levels of heat generated during operation without compromising performance.
- Gain Bandwidth Product (fT): The 2SC4411 boasts a gain bandwidth product of 120MHz, providing a good balance between amplification and frequency response.
